require_relative "../helpers"
module ChefCLI
module CookbookProfiler
class Git
include Helpers
@@git_memo = {}
attr_reader :cookbook_path
def initialize(cookbook_path)
@cookbook_path = cookbook_path
@unborn_branch = nil
@unborn_branch_ref = nil
end
# @return [Hash] Hashed used for pinning cookbook versions within a Policyfile.lock
def profile_data
{
"scm" => "git",
# To get this info, you need to do something like:
# figure out branch or assume 'main'
# git config --get branch.main.remote
# git config --get remote.opscode.url
"remote" => remote,
"revision" => revision,
"working_tree_clean" => clean?,
"published" => !unpublished_commits?,
"synchronized_remote_branches" => synchronized_remotes,
}
end
def revision
git!("rev-parse HEAD").stdout.strip
rescue Mixlib::ShellOut::ShellCommandFailed => e
# We may have an "unborn" branch, i.e. one with no commits.
if unborn_branch_ref
nil
else
# if we got here, but verify_ref_cmd didn't error, we don't know why
# the original git command failed, so re-raise.
raise e
end
end
def clean?
git!("diff-files --quiet", returns: [0, 1]).exitstatus == 0
end
def unpublished_commits?
synchronized_remotes.empty?
end
def synchronized_remotes
@synchronized_remotes ||= git!("branch -r --contains #{revision}").stdout.lines.map(&:strip)
rescue Mixlib::ShellOut::ShellCommandFailed => e
# We may have an "unborn" branch, i.e. one with no commits.
if unborn_branch_ref
[]
else
# if we got here, but verify_ref_cmd didn't error, we don't know why
# the original git command failed, so re-raise.
raise e
end
end
def remote
@remote_url ||=
if have_remote?
git!("config --get remote.#{remote_name}.url").stdout.strip
else
nil
end
end
def remote_name
@remote_name ||= git!("config --get branch.#{current_branch}.remote", returns: [0, 1]).stdout.strip
end
def have_remote?
!remote_name.empty? && remote_name != "."
end
def current_branch
@current_branch ||= detect_current_branch
end
private
def git!(subcommand, options = {})
cmd = git(subcommand, options)
cmd.error!
cmd
end
def git(subcommand, options = {})
memo_key = [subcommand, options]
if @@git_memo.has_key?(memo_key)
rv = @@git_memo[memo_key]
else
options = { cwd: cookbook_path }.merge(options)
rv = system_command("git #{subcommand}", options)
@@git_memo[memo_key] = rv
end
rv
end
def detect_current_branch
branch = git!("rev-parse --abbrev-ref HEAD").stdout.strip
@unborn_branch = false
branch
rescue Mixlib::ShellOut::ShellCommandFailed => e
# "unborn" branch, i.e. one with no commits or
# verify_ref_cmd didn't error, we don't know why
# the original git command failed, so re-raise.
unborn_branch_ref || raise(e)
end
def unborn_branch_ref
@unborn_branch_ref ||=
begin
strict_branch_ref = git!("symbolic-ref -q HEAD").stdout.strip
verify_ref_cmd = git("show-ref --verify #{strict_branch_ref}")
if verify_ref_cmd.error?
@unborn_branch = true
strict_branch_ref
else
# if we got here, but verify_ref_cmd didn't error, then `git
# rev-parse` is probably failing for a reason we haven't anticipated.
# Calling code should detect this and re-raise.
nil
end
end
end
end
end
end
